£8 million for Skegness roads in Devolution deal
National World - Other Local Sites
Follow
19/01/2024
The Greater Lincolnshire Devolution Consultation Tour has visited Skegness with the news the proposed deal includes £8 million to improve Roman Bank.

Can you explain what devolution would mean to Lincolnshire?
00:12
So devolution, the principles of devolution are about the government devolving powers and
00:17
responsibility and resources for things that are currently managed from Whitehall
00:22
down to Greater Lincolnshire. So that is Greater Lincolnshire being a combination
00:27
of the areas of the County Council and the two unitary authorities of North and North-East Lincolnshire.
00:32
So for example, currently there are certain parameters set to how we utilise things like
00:38
the adult education budget where the outputs are set by Whitehall.
00:42
Once that budget is devolved to Lincolnshire we would establish the requirements of how
00:47
that money would be best spent to make sure that our educational providers were providing
00:51
the right courses, the right training to meet Lincolnshire's needs.
00:55
One of the other underlying principles is the importance of delivering the right infrastructure
00:59
in the right place at the right time. So rather than having to bid into central government
01:04
departments on an annual basis, a mayoral investment fund would give us greater control
01:09
to actually make our own decisions on our own priorities and deliver the type of infrastructure
01:14
that we want to actually see. So for example, in the first round of funding that's been
01:19
released there's a proposal to deliver an £8 million improvement scheme to Roman Bank
01:26
which will enhance and improve the infrastructure to access to the coast. So that's an immediate
01:32
quick win for the coastal communities of this area.
01:36
Now some people are claiming this is just going to be an extra layer of bureaucracy.
01:41
Is that right? The proposal is that the mayor, the directly
01:47
elected mayor, will be responsible for the devolved powers that are being released to
01:51
Greater Lincolnshire from Whitehall. The existing authorities, whether it's a parish council
01:56
level, district council level or county council level, will continue to be responsible for
02:01
those functions. The mayor's responsibilities are a different set or a new set of functions
02:06
and responsibilities. It's not about the mayor taking ownership or overall control of what
02:11
the existing authorities currently actually do. So the devolving of the adult education
02:17
budget, as an example, is about actually local control of new powers for Lincolnshire.
02:23
Is it going to cost local taxpayers more? The proposals at the moment include provision
02:29
for set-up costs to be funded as part and parcel of the establishment of the deal and
02:34
within the investment fund there will be the opportunity for the mayoral combined authority
02:41
to be responsible for its own costs. If there is a need for the other authorities to actually
02:46
provide funding to it, that will be something that will be subject to a democratic debate
02:51
and discussion across those authorities.
